# Ward E Councilman James Solomon Receives Major Healthcare Union Endorsement in Mayoral Race
Jersey City’s mayoral race just took an interesting turn. Councilman James Solomon landed the endorsement of the Committee of Interns and Residents SEIU (CIR), which could be a game-changer for his campaign.

This union is the largest housestaff group in the country. It represents thousands of resident physicians and fellows who work to improve healthcare training, education, and patient care—both nationally and at local places like Jersey City Medical Center and Christ Hospital.
Understanding the CIR SEIU Endorsement
The Committee of Interns and Residents SEIU has a strong presence in healthcare. Its members work directly with patients in all kinds of settings.
When they endorse a candidate, especially in a race where healthcare is front and center, it really means something.
What This Means for Solomon’s Campaign
For Solomon, this isn’t just another endorsement. It feels like a real nod to his healthcare platform.

He said he’s proud to get the union’s support and that he’s focused on making healthcare accessible for all Jersey City residents, no matter their income or background.
“Working alongside CIR SEIU, we can bring meaningful change to our healthcare system,” Solomon said. He’s eager to team up with healthcare professionals and tackle the bigger issues.
Healthcare Professionals Voice Their Support
Dr. Russell Yee, a resident physician at Jersey City Medical Center and CIR SEIU member, shared why the union decided to back Solomon.
The Connection Between Policy and Community Health
Dr. Yee pointed out that local policy choices really do shape community health. “James Solomon has consistently demonstrated his support for working people in our community,” he said.
He mentioned Solomon’s record of standing up for tenants, workers, and families during his time on the city council. That kind of advocacy doesn’t go unnoticed.
There’s a real link between housing, workers’ rights, and public health—areas where Solomon has put in the work as councilman.
Growing Momentum for Solomon’s Mayoral Bid
The CIR SEIU endorsement comes at a pretty crucial moment for Solomon. His campaign’s ramping up, and this support could give him an edge as a progressive with real ideas for making life better in Jersey City.
